Take a bow onstage and get a peek behind the curtains during this morning's inaugural
Theater Tour of Playhouse Square's eight historic show palaces. As you walk through the State and its sister theaters, guides will narrate the stages' 86 years of history, from their opulent 1921 debuts to their massive restorations in the '80s and '90s. And pay close attention to the four murals on the walls of the State Theatre lobby: They're the last works by the late American modernist James Daugherty to remain where they were originally painted. The tours start at 10 a.m. at the State Theatre, 1501 Euclid Avenue. Admission is free. Call 216-771-4444 or visit
